2. Summer Program/CampsProgramming, specialized camps, or respite to help support and maintain function of children with special health and wellness needs through the summer months. Services can be designed to address and develop skills in areas of socialization, communication, self expression, self esteem, and interpersonal relationships. Programming will also improve fitness, physical skills, ability to follow rules and directions, share and play cooperatively.

7. 1:1 Supervision / Mentoring / Classroom AssistanceIndividual attention, supervision, monitoring, or support given to a youth in order to improve function, increase participation, and stabilize symptoms in a school setting.
-
4. After School ProgramsProgramming to support children after school, in school building or at community locations. It can also provide for communication outlets for parents, schools, and students. After school programming can include homework assistance and academic support, health, Drug and alcohol, or mental health groups and treatment.

5. Family Outreach / Groups / SEL GroupsOutreach to parents and caregivers to have access to supports, local services, and resources. Assisting families with communication techniques to better partner effectively with schools, mental health professionals, juvenile court, health services and children's protective services.
